Beyond the 'African Elephant': Unpacking the Scientific Name and Two Distinct Species

When we talk about the magnificent African elephant, we often use the common name, picturing those iconic, enormous creatures with their sweeping ears. But delve a little deeper, and you'll find that the scientific world has a more nuanced understanding. The genus for these giants is Loxodonta. It's a name that, while perhaps not as instantly recognizable as 'elephant,' carries the weight of scientific classification for these incredible mammals.

What's truly fascinating, and perhaps surprising to many, is that 'African elephant' isn't just one monolithic species anymore. Scientists have come to understand that there are actually two distinct species within the Loxodonta genus, and both are facing serious threats. We have the savanna elephant (Loxodonta africana), the larger of the two, known for its wide-ranging travels across the plains of sub-Saharan Africa. Then there's the forest elephant (Loxodonta cyclotis), a slightly smaller, more elusive cousin that calls the dense rainforests of Central and West Africa home.

This distinction is more than just a scientific curiosity; it has significant implications for conservation. The International Union for Conservation of Nature (IUCN) lists savanna elephants as 'endangered' and forest elephants as 'critically endangered.' This means the forest dwellers are teetering on the very brink of extinction, a sobering thought for such a vital part of their ecosystems.

These elephants are often called 'ecosystem engineers,' and for good reason. They don't just live in their environment; they actively shape it. Think about the dry season: their powerful tusks are used to dig down to where water might still be hidden in dry riverbeds, creating precious watering holes for countless other animals. And their droppings? They're not just waste; they're a seed dispersal system, helping plants spread, and even provide a cozy habitat for dung beetles. In the forests, their browsing creates pathways, and on the savannas, their tree-uprooting habits keep the landscape open, benefiting grazers like zebras.

Their famous trunks, a marvel of biological engineering with around 40,000 muscles, are incredibly versatile. They're used for smelling, breathing, trumpeting, drinking, and, of course, for delicately plucking food. And those tusks, present in both males and females, are actually continuously growing teeth, used for digging, stripping bark, and, in the case of males, for sparring. It's interesting to note the subtle differences: savanna elephants tend to have curving tusks, while forest elephants' are straighter.

Understanding the scientific name Loxodonta and recognizing the two distinct species within it helps us appreciate the complexity and vulnerability of these gentle giants. It's a reminder that conservation efforts need to be tailored to the specific needs of each species, ensuring their survival for generations to come.
